WebMay 5, 2014 · 47. A fixed point number just means that there are a fixed number of digits after the decimal point. A floating point number allows for a varying number of digits after the decimal point. For example, if you have a way of storing numbers that requires exactly four digits after the decimal point, then it is fixed point. WebDec 8, 2024 · Step 2: Identify the customer segment. WebOct 24, 2024 · The reorder point (ROP) is the minimum number of units that a business needs to have in stock to prevent stock outs and ensure order fulfillment. Once inventory levels reach the reorder point, this triggers the replenishment process to reorder that item.
